How To Choose the Right Grooming Schedule
Finding the right grooming schedule for your dog can feel confusing, especially when coat types and activity levels vary so much. We help you look at your dog’s daily life in the Middletown area and match it with a grooming plan that keeps them comfortable without overdoing it. This way, you can plan ahead and avoid last-minute appointments when your pup’s coat is already matted or dirty.
Short-coated dogs who mostly stroll around the neighborhood may only need occasional baths and nail trims, while long-coated or double-coated breeds that love running around places like local parks often do better with more frequent visits. We also consider whether your pup swims, spends time along the Jersey shoreline, or joins you for hikes on weekends, since those outings can lead to extra tangles and debris in the coat. Talking through these details helps us suggest a realistic schedule that fits your routine.
As your dog settles into Camp, we pay attention to how their coat and skin respond between appointments. If we notice that nails are getting long sooner than expected or their coat is matting in a certain area, we can let you know and help you tweak the timing. Preparing Your Dog for a Successful Grooming Day
A little preparation at home can make grooming days smoother and more enjoyable for your dog. When pups arrive feeling rested and familiar with basic handling, they tend to settle into our Camp routine more quickly. This is especially helpful for younger dogs or those who are still getting used to new experiences away from home.
On the morning of your visit, it helps to give your dog a chance for a short walk and a bathroom break before heading to Camp. Avoid feeding a large meal right before drop-off, since a very full stomach can make some dogs feel uneasy when they get excited during play. If your pup has a favorite brush, command, or calming routine you use at home, let us know so we can keep things as familiar as possible during their time with us.
Getting your dog comfortable with gentle handling between appointments can also make a big difference. Simple things like touching their paws, ears, and tail for a few seconds at a time, and rewarding calm behavior, can help them feel more relaxed when we trim nails or clean ears here at Camp. Over time, many dogs learn that grooming days near Middletown are predictable, friendly experiences, which can reduce stress for both you and your pup.
